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
900854 883217389 957
81 7652866
81 7652866
690923 82167614 26773
All about undefined
Interested in learning more?
81 7652866
690923 82167614 26773
See more
6714434605 9824374566
17 5616 9184520 1606
See more
224 61313814174
061458 618903 500512886 72371965821 273
See more